Birches Vintage Day a big success

Carla Lockhart MP • July 9, 2025

Upper Bann MP, Carla Lockhart, has praised the success of the Birches Vintage and Classic Car Club’s Annual Vintage Day, describing it as a fantastic community event that continues to go from strength to strength.

Attending the event over the weekend, the DUP MP took the opportunity to meet with organisers, stallholders, and supporters, and to express her thanks to all involved in delivering a day of nostalgia, community spirit, and charitable giving.


Speaking following the event, Carla Lockhart said:

“The Birches Vintage Day is one of those special events that truly brings the community together. It was a real pleasure to be invited once again, and I want to extend my heartfelt thanks to the one and only John Wilson, whose heart and soul go into making this day such a success.

From the impressive display of vintage vehicles, cars, motorbikes, tractors, and more, to the atmosphere created by local stalls, volunteers, and visitors, this was a truly memorable occasion. The passion and pride of the Birches Vintage and Classic Car Club is evident in every aspect of the event.”

Carla Lockhart also welcomed the charitable focus of the day, noting the presence of several important organisations:

“It was great to see charities like the Samaritans and the Northern Ireland Hospice represented at the event and benefiting from the generosity of those attending. This community always rallies behind good causes, and the fundraising element of the Vintage Day makes it all the more meaningful.

Events like this don’t just happen, they are the result of hours of planning, hard work, and dedication from volunteers. The Birches Vintage and Classic Car Club deserve huge credit, and I want to thank each and every person involved. This is a day that brings joy, supports worthy causes, and celebrates the rich heritage of our community.”

The Birches Vintage Day continues to grow in popularity, with visitors travelling from across the region to enjoy a unique family day out steeped in local pride and vintage charm.
